The Rule 25S is a common automatic bilge pump that some folks use
http://www.xylemflowcontrol.com/marine-and-rv/bilge/rule-electric-submersible-pumps/rule-500.htm
The flow rate at the exit of the pump is 500gph. Add a two meter lift and
the flow falls to 260gph http://www.xylemflowcontrol.com/files/950-0518.pdf

> >> Any automatic bilge pump should only be relied upon to evacuate
> minor
> >> leaks when you’re not aboard. So any pump will do… I believe the
> 450 gal
> >> per hour variety is nice and small, and won’t run your battery down
> too
> >> much.
> >>
> >> I personally (well professionally too) have a prejudice against
> automatic
> >> pumps. Here’s why. The main thing an automatic pump will do is
> hide a
> >> problem from you. You’ll never know your boat has developed a
> chronic leak
> >> until one day you arrive and the bilge is full and your batteries
> dead.
> >> Worse, you may be happily sailing and notice that your bilge is
> full, your
> >> battery is dead, you can’t start the engine, and because the water
> is up
> >> you can’t find which hose or whatever is causing the problem.
> >>
> >> A very powerful electric pump which might keep up with the ingress
> of
> >> water from a ¾” through hull whose hose has fallen off, will only
> keep up
> >> the fight for a relatively short time before it kills the battery.
> >>
> >> I know some insurance companies, usually non-marine specialists,
> think an
> >> automatic bilge pump is a safety item, but actually it is the
> opposite, in
> >> this writer’s opinion.
> >>
> >> You can buy a meter that will let you know if and how many times
> the pump
> >> has come on… but strangely enough most people don’t use them.
> >>
> >> Your best defense against a leak is vigilance. Vigilance in
> prevention
> >> (good hoses, good clamping, good through hulls, a regimen that
> involves
> >> closing ball valves when you’re not using that through hull) Your
> second
> >> defense is your manual pump. Last and least is your electric pump.
